The Sussex Beacon to launch new course – Mindful Living – from September Local HIV charity the Sussex Beacon is launching a new course – Mindful Living – to run Monday afternoons (2 – 4pm) from September 5 – November 7.

Update on vaccination to protect against Monkeypox in England As of August 10, around 27,000 people have been vaccinated by the NHS and in sexual health services in England, including 25,325 gay, bisexual and other men who have sex with men.
